1 Pass Heat Exchanger Overview

At its core, a 1 Pass Heat Exchanger is designed to transfer heat between two fluids in a single, continuous flow path. Unlike multipass exchangers, where the fluid flows back and forth, this one-pass system simplifies the fluid path — which frankly, reduces pressure drop and allows for more predictable performance. Adaptability is the name of the game here, and many sectors from chemical processing to HVAC systems rely on these units. Oddly enough, despite sounding straightforward, the design and material choice can get pretty technical. For example, many 1 Pass Heat Exchangers from CASITING use stainless steel or titanium alloys, depending on the application environment.

  • Designed for efficient heat transfer with minimal pressure loss.
  • Typical construction materials include stainless steel, copper alloys, and titanium.
  • Commonly used in fluid-to-fluid and fluid-to-gas heat exchange configurations.

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Pass Heat Exchanger

What is 1 Pass Heat Exchanger and how does it work?
A 1 Pass Heat Exchanger allows two fluids to exchange heat by flowing side by side through a single path in one direction. This design minimizes flow complexity and pressure loss, making heat transfer more consistent and predictable.
What are the main benefits of using 1 Pass Heat Exchanger in industrial applications?
Key benefits include durability, simplified maintenance, cost-effectiveness, and reliable performance under various industrial conditions.
How does 1 Pass Heat Exchanger compare to traditional alternatives?
Compared to multipass or plate heat exchangers, 1 Pass models offer lower pressure drops and easier cleaning, although they may have less heat transfer surface area for some applications.
What industries can benefit most from 1 Pass Heat Exchanger implementation?
Industries like chemical processing, HVAC, power generation, and food and beverage processing benefit greatly, where efficient and reliable heat exchange is critical.
